§ 33-11-86 — Management of investment pool

Georgia·Title 33

For an investment in an investment pool to be qualified under this article, the manager of the investment pool shall:

(1)Be organized under the laws of the United States or a state and designated as the pool manager in a pooling agreement;
(2)Be the insurer, an affiliated insurer or a business entity affiliated with the insurer, a qualified bank, or a business entity registered under the Investment Advisors Act of 1940, 15 U.S.C. Section 80b-1 , et seq., as amended; or, in the case of a reciprocal insurer or interinsurance exchange, be its attorney in fact; or, in cases of a United States branch of an alien insurer, be its United States manager or affiliates or subsidiaries of its United States manager;
